A survey asked what would make investors more interested in KKR stock. The top responses were a market pullback (50%), attractive returns/book value growth (33%), and stronger fee related earnings (17%).
This document is a Bank of America Merrill Lynch research note from its '2016 Future of Financials Conference' on November 17, 2016, summarizing a presentation by KKR's CFO, Bill Janetschek. It details KKR's financial strategy, investor sentiment regarding its stock, and its focus on infrastructure as a growth area.
